    Lindhom Sponsers Food Freedom Act

    Wyoming Food Freedom Act. Great bill! I may be biased though as I am the prime sponsor on this bill. I have been lucky enough to have Representatives Hunt and Blake, and Senator Driskill join me in sponsorship for HB56.

    The premise of this bill is to simply take food off of the black market. How many times have you purchased homemade foods or bought eggs or milk from a local producer? In certain cases, your actions may have been against the law in our great state, and this bill aims to strike down unnecessary regulations that may have kept you from purchasing local goods in the past.

    I would be remiss to not mention the efforts of the late Representative Sue Wallis, who brought this bill in the past, and I believe has paved the way for this bill once again.

    This bill is all about Individual Liberty and Agriculture Production, both of which are part of the backbone in the great state of Wyoming.
